Comprehending Cataract Surgical Procedure Process



Checking out the actions associated with cataract surgical treatment can assist reduce any anxiousness or unpredictability you may have regarding the treatment. Cataract surgery is an usual and highly successful treatment that includes getting rid of the gloomy lens in your eye and replacing it with a clear artificial lens.

The cosmetic surgeon will make a tiny incision in your eye to access the cataract and break it up utilizing ultrasound waves prior to thoroughly removing it.

Post-Operative Care Tips



After cataract surgical procedure, offering proper post-operative treatment is essential for your loved one's recovery. Guarantee they wear the safety guard over their eye as advised by the medical professional. Help them carry out prescribed eye declines and medicines promptly to stop infection and aid recovery.

Encourage your liked one to avoid touching or rubbing their eyes, as this can bring about problems. Aid them in following any kind of limitations on flexing, raising heavy items, or taking part in exhausting tasks to avoid pressure on the eyes. Ensure they attend all follow-up visits with the eye medical professional for checking progression.



Maintain the eye area clean and completely dry, staying clear of water or soap directly in the eyes. Motivate your enjoyed one to use sunglasses to safeguard their eyes from bright light and glare during the recovery procedure. Be patient and encouraging as they recover, supplying support with day-to-day tasks as required.
